Exactly How Sales Transactions Are Refined
When a customer chooses to purchase, the sales purchase starts a collection of methodical actions within the POS system. First, the cashier inputs the items being purchased, which are checked with a barcode viewers or manually gone into. This action gets item details, consisting of rates and applicable tax obligations, from the system's database.Next, the consumer is offered with the total amount due. The POS system then refines the repayment, whether through money, charge card, or mobile payment methods (Restaurant POS Software). For electronic settlements, the POS securely interacts with payment processors to authorize and validate the transaction.Once the settlement is verified, the system produces a receipt, which can be published or sent out digitally. This receipt acts as proof of purchase for the consumer. The transaction information is videotaped in the system, making sure accurate sales records and monetary monitoring for the company.Inventory Administration and Tracking

Reliable supply management and tracking are necessary elements of a POS system, as they guarantee that services keep excellent stock degrees and decrease disparities. A durable POS system enables real-time supply updates, showing returns and sales instantaneously. This allows company owner to check supply degrees properly, guaranteeing that prominent products are readily available while stopping overstocking of less popular products.Additionally, advanced POS systems offer functions such as automatic supply alerts and reorder tips, simplifying the purchase process. Barcoding and RFID innovation improve accuracy in tracking supply motion, lowering human mistake. Substantial coverage tools provide insights into stock turn over prices, aiding companies make informed choices concerning buying and item offerings. Eventually, efficient stock monitoring with a POS system not only enhances functional efficiency yet additionally enhances customer contentment by making sure item accessibility.

What Kinds Of Services Can Gain From a POS System?
Various companies take advantage of a POS system, including retail stores, dining establishments, beauty salons, and e-commerce systems. These systems enhance deals, inventory management, and consumer data, boosting operational efficiency and improving client experience across varied markets.How Much Does a POS System Generally Cost?
The expense of a POS system normally varies from a couple of hundred to numerous thousand bucks, relying on features, hardware, and software program. Services must take into consideration recurring costs for assistance, maintenance, and deal handling when budgeting.
